I'm not sure if this is even possible but I'm going to ask anyway. My
boss wants a setup that allows a 24/7 real time camera view of the cash
register and various points throughout the store through his computer,
which I think is possible... but he also wants a camera view of the cash
register from our other location 45 miles away. Is this possible? I'm
thinking that if we get DSL with a static IP at the other location then
I should be able to set up something with a relatively cheap computer
and camera. I'm just not sure where to start looking... and google
gives me an endless sea of possibilities.
